Guwahati, Nov 29: The 56th International Film Festival of India (IFFI) drew to a spectacular close at Panaji, Goa on November 28 with a ceremony that transformed the festival stage into one of the country’s most extensive cultural showcases, highlighting India’s folk heritage, classical traditions, and contemporary artistic expression.

This year’s closing programme was designed as a sweeping national presentation—spanning the deserts of Rajasthan, the coastal arts of Karnataka, and the devotional traditions of India—reflecting the spirit of Ek Bharat Shreshtha Bharat. But the evening’s standout highlight was the Northeast Cultural Showcase, curated by renowned artist Ranjit Gogoi, marking one of the festival’s most expansive representations of the region to date.
The Northeast was presented through a two-part programme celebrating both its deep ties to Indian cinema and the distinct cultural identities of its eight states.
The first segment featured a high-energy musical and dance tribute to the works of Dr. Bhupen Hazarika, S.D. Burman, R.D. Burman, Zubeen Garg, and Papon, underscoring the region’s enduring influence on India’s cinematic soundscape.

The second segment delivered a sweeping folk panorama from across the Northeast, featuring Nyapa Cham and Zya Cham (Arunachal Pradesh), Bihu (Assam), Cheraw/Bamboo Dance (Mizoram), Wangala (Meghalaya), Pung Cholom (Manipur), Sangrain (Tripura) ,Warrior Dance (Nagaland) and Singhi Chaam (Sikkim).

Together, the performances showcased the region’s rich rhythm traditions, lyrical diversity, and vibrant colours—emerging as one of the most visually striking segments of the entire closing ceremony.
